  • In 1978 the bionic ear was invented by a team of researchers from the University of Melbourne, lead by Professor Graeme Clark. The bionic ear now provides hearing for over 50,000 partially or completely deaf people in 120 countries across the world
  • Four Australian Prime Ministers have graduated from The University of Melbourne, including Australia’s first female Prime Minister, Julia Gillard
  • Nobel Prize winner Peter Doherty and prominent moral philosopher, Laureate Professor Peter Singer are just two of the many distinguished scholars who teach and research at the University of Melbourne

  • Oral Health

    Careers Bachelor of Oral Health graduates provide dental care in a collaborative and referral relationship with a dentist and work as oral health therapists (dental therapists and hygienists) in both the public and private sectors; in general and specialist practice; and in oral health promotion, research and teaching

    Pathology

    Careers A major in Pathology can open up career opportunities in a range of laboratory settings. These include research laboratories in universities, hospitals or research institutes; diagnostic laboratories in hospitals and private diagnostic pathology services; and biotechnology laboratories. You could also find work or undertake further study in a broad range of areas, such as education, the pharmaceutical or scientific equipment industries, journalism, or publishing

    Performance Design

    Careers Performance designers play a pivotal and collaborative part in the conception and realisation of a performance in an assortment of potential roles such as set designer, costume designer, lighting designer and sound designer

    Pharmacology

    Careers A Pharmacology major will provide the springboard for you to enter a career in many areas of biomedical research and associated industries. Graduates will gain an in-depth understanding of drug actions and a broad appreciation of the scientific process of knowledge acquisition and problem-solving
